Claimed Features and What to Verify
Marketing copy on the site highlights "high payout rates," "instant withdrawals," and "24/7 support." These are common phrases in the industry, but they carry weight only when backed by verifiable information. Below is a short checklist of claims a player can test without committing money.
| Claim on Site | What to Check |
|---|---|
| High payout percentages | Look for published RTP figures per game. If absent, consider the claim unsubstantiated. |
| Instant withdrawals | Check the terms for minimum amounts, pending periods, and verification steps. "Instant" often means after internal approval. |
| 24/7 customer support | Test response time via live chat or email at different hours. Note whether replies are scripted or helpful. |
| Fair gameplay | Look for third-party audit logos or game provider accreditation. Without this, fairness remains a claim. |

Risks and How to Verify the Platform's Promises
No matter how attractive an arcade platform looks, risks exist. Below are the most common ones and practical steps to reduce them.
Unverified Payout Mechanics
Arcade games on unregulated sites sometimes have hidden parameters that adjust difficulty based on player behaviour. Without an independent audit, you cannot confirm that the game is truly random. To mitigate this, look for games from well-known providers such as Pragmatic Play, Spribe, or Habanero, which usually have their own certifications. If the platform only uses white-label games from unknown studios, consider that a red flag.
Withdrawal Hurdles
A common complaint across gaming forums involves players who win a modest amount only to face withdrawal delays or document requests. Before depositing, note the platform's stated processing times. If the terms say "up to 72 hours" for e-wallets, expect that it might take the full window. For cryptocurrency withdrawals, anything beyond 24 hours is slow by industry standards. Keep a record of your transactions and any communication with support.
Account Restrictions
Some platforms limit accounts that show consistent winning patterns. These restrictions are usually written into the terms of service under clauses like "bonus abuse" or "irregular play." To protect yourself, avoid using bonuses if you are not comfortable with the wagering conditions, and play within sensible bankroll limits. A good rule is never to deposit more than you are prepared to lose in a single session.
